Minister of State for Finance Bhagwat Karad has informed the Rajya Sabha that a total of 18 crore and 50 lakh beneficiaries were enrolled under the Pradhan Mantri Jeevan Jyoti Bima Yojana (PMJJBY) and Pradhan Mantri Suraksha Bima Yojana (PMSBY) during the last three years. These two insurance schemes are for poor and individuals from underprivileged backgrounds, thereby reducing their financial vulnerability. Earlier these two schemes were incurring losses and after a review, the annual premium for the PMSBY was increased from 12 rupees to 20 rupees for accidental death cum disability cover of 2 lakh rupees. The premium of PMJJBY was increased to 436 rupees from 330 rupees earlier for a life cover of 2 Lakh rupees in case of death due to any reason.
